Output d32c66745b5b74e9841417d64299e075a87a4f7e6c8f9b0a895b60071d7c3d11:0

value
166586869
script pubkey
OP_0 OP_PUSHBYTES_20 ed156bb08510ee1d8a710f711a89f0c9b6ae520c
address
bc1qa52khvy9zrhpmzn3pac34z0sexm2u5svg0grf4
transaction
d32c66745b5b74e9841417d64299e075a87a4f7e6c8f9b0a895b60071d7c3d11
spent
true